Cyclist Loses His Bike at Gunpoint in CC

 

November 4, 2021

A cyclist on a leisure ride on Sawtelle Boulevard was held up at gunpoint by another cyclist who stole his bike last week, Culver City police said.

The armed robbery occurred at 7:45 a.m. on October 21 near the vicinity of Braddock Dr. and Sawtelle Blvd., according to the Culver City Police Department.

The victim told police he was riding his bicycle on Sawtelle under the 405 freeway when the suspect, on a bicycle in front of him, "blocked his path and told the victim the bike belonged to his friend," police said said in a press release.

"The suspect then pulled out a handgun, pointed it at the victim and told him to walk the other way or he would shoot him," police said "In fear for his life, he gave the suspect the bicycle and walked northbound Sawtelle and out of the area."

The suspect then rode his bicycle in tandem with the stolen bicycle southbound Sawtelle Blvd., according to police. He is described as a male, Hispanic, approximately 47 years old, 5'8" medium build wearing a black hat, white t-shirt, and a grey sweater.
